Output 415dd73b3ed28a1e9b1cbfb14c8197d87b7c1bf6e3746863acd948dd1d91652a:0

value
3407886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 345e3e9e526e79691e7a80fdbb673937f0bfc42e OP_EQUALVERIFY OP_CHECKSIG
address
15mu3CtgMqwzw12SYUnj5K6YrjDHYfdty9
transaction
415dd73b3ed28a1e9b1cbfb14c8197d87b7c1bf6e3746863acd948dd1d91652a
spent
true